1. Summary
This deliverable is the robot platform user and developer manual. It explains the way the different
components are integrated, where they are connected and how they communicate.
The structure of the document is as follows:
• FROG Robot Features and Components - This chapter describes the main robot features that
have been specified in the previous Work Package deliverables. It gives an overview of the
different components that have been integrated, their function, placement on the robot, and
internet links for the component manuals.
• FROG Robot Architecture - The adopted power and communication architecture is explained.
The chapter begins with a description of how the robot components will be powered. A table
with the component energy distribution per battery shows an even distribution of the battery
power consumption. The last two sub-chapters are dedicated to explaining the low-level
communication, showing the way the developed electronics communicate with each sensor
and actuator, and the high-level communication between the onboard computers, interaction
and navigation sensors and actuators.
• FROG Robot Electronics - All of the electronics that have been projected, designed, produced
and programmed within the project are explained.
• Low-level Control Loops - The electronics control boards that are controlling the motors and
onboard power all run low-level control loops and interrupt driven events that control the
system and also check for faults in the normal operation of the platform. This chapter explains
the low-level software running inside the microcontrollers that control the FROG base
platform.
• Safety - During the first review meeting, issues of human-robot interaction safety were raised.
This chapter shows the safety procedures that have been implemented.
• Working with the Robot - This is a manual with simple instructions for running the robot.
• FROG Integration Meetings - In the first half of the second year two integration meetings were
conducted, one in the Royal Alcázar in Seville and one the Lisbon Zoo. The chapter describes
the work of each partner during those two events.
• Tests and Results - This chapter describes some of the tests performed with the robot and
their results.
Additionally to the manual, three technical annexes have been added:
• Board Connections - This is the manual of connections between each board connector and
each cable inside the robot.
• Board Controllers Software Protocol - This section explains the low-level control protocol
implemented between the onboard navigation computer and the Sensor&Management and
Motor Board and also between the interaction computer and the Interaction Board.
• Robot Platform CAD Measurements - This section shows CAD representations of the
dimensions of the robot.
